Apache 2.4.66 VS18 httpd crashes.
I rolled back to Apache 2.4.65 VS17 and seems to have gone away.
Running Windows Server 2019. With PHP 8.5.1 in FastCGI
I've been trying to track down the cause of my Apache server crashes for a few days now, and I'm starting to run out of ideas. The crash occurs once or twice a day.
Last crash:
Apache log:
| Quote: | [Thu Jan 15 20:21:20.053285 2026] [mpm_winnt:notice] [pid 13988:tid 548] AH00428: Parent: child process 3252 exited with status 3221226356 -- Restarting.

| I have found the cause of the issue. It was being caused by the PDO_OCI 1.2.0 for Windows extension. After disabling it, the problem was resolved. I'm closing this thread now. |

| unfortunately I'm facing exactly same issue with latest apache 2.4.66 (vs17 and vs18) in my windows server and everything I tried (set ThreadStackSize 8388608 / AcceptFilter none, switching through different php versions, even tried mod_fcgid) did not worked, it regulary crash, I'll probably gonna rollback to previously 2.4.65 soon. |
